Oman Air Chooses AFI KLM E&M for 737NG Engine Support

Oman Air has chosen Air France Industries KLM Engineering and Maintenance (AFI KLM E&M) to provide flight hour support for the CFM56-7 power plants that equip the airline’s Boeing 737NG aircraft.
The long term contract was formally signed in Amstelveen, The Netherlands, by Oman Air CEO Paul Gregorowitsch and Ton Dortmans, Executive Vice President KLM E&M, in the presence of His Excellency Mohammed bin Harub bin Abdullah Al Said and KLM President and CEO, Dr Ing Pieter Elbers.
Oman Air’s decision was taken following receipt of a highly competitive offer and the new contract builds on a working relationship between the two companies that has existed for a number of years. It will enable the Airline to maintain its excellent record for safety, reliability and on-time performance for many years to come.
Oman Air’s Chief Executive Officer, Paul Gregorowitsch, commented: “AFI KLM E&M has a well-deserved, outstanding reputation for maintaining CF M56-7 power plants and we are pleased to be signing this new contract with the company. Oman Air’s over-riding priorities are the safety of its passengers and crew, the reliability of its aircraft and an excellent on-time performance. AFI KLM E&M’s expertise and professionalism will help us to maintain our unblemished record in each of these vital areas.”
Franck Terner, Executive Vice President AFI KLM E&M, added:
“We have worked regularly with Oman Air for several years. I am very pleased that the airline has now shown us this mark of trust by opting for our engine know-how.”
The new partnership was announce as Oman Air continues its ambitious programme of fleet and network expansion. This will see the national carrier of the Sultanate of Oman increase its fleet size from 30 aircraft at the start of the programme to 70 aircraft by 2020. These are expected to comprise 25 wide-body and 45 narrow-body aircraft, with the vast majority of the narrow-body fleet consisting of Boeing 737s. Four additional 737s will join Oman Air’s fleet in 2016, in addition to two more 787 Dreamliners.
AFI KLM E&M is a major multi-product maintenance, repair and overhaul (MRO) provider. With a workforce of over 14,000, the company offers comprehensive technical support for airlines. This ranges from engineering and line maintenance to engine overhaul, aero structure and FTR support. AFI KLM E&M also offers the management, repair and supply of aircraft components, structured around a powerful logistics network. The company currently supports almost 1,500 aircraft operated by 200 major international and domestic airlines.
